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1481 connectés 

  FORUM HardWare.fr
  Linux et OS Alternatifs

  Problème de lancement Mysql

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

Problème de lancement Mysql

n°529708
Pierre-Luc
Posté le 28-07-2004 à 21:23:53  profilanswer
 

J'ai installé la version 4.0.20 de Mysql à partir de l'installation de Slackware 10.0. Le problème se trouve au niveau de la configuration du mot de passe root mysql. Tout d'abord j'ai lancé mysql_install_db et obtenu:
 
Installing all prepared tables
040728 12:01:01  /usr/libexec/mysqld: Shutdown Complete
 
 
To start mysqld at boot time you have to copy support-files/mysql.server
to the right place for your system
 
PLEASE REMEMBER TO SET A PASSWORD FOR THE MySQL root USER !
To do so, start the server, then issue the following commands:
/usr/bin/mysqladmin -u root password 'new-password'
/usr/bin/mysqladmin -u root -h slack password 'new-password'
See the manual for more instructions.
 
NOTE:  If you are upgrading from a MySQL <= 3.22.10 you should run
the /usr/bin/mysql_fix_privilege_tables. Otherwise you will not be
able to use the new GRANT command!
 
You can start the MySQL daemon with:
cd /usr ; /usr/bin/mysqld_safe &
 
You can test the MySQL daemon with the benchmarks in the 'sql-bench' directory:
cd sql-bench ; perl run-all-tests
 
Please report any problems with the /usr/bin/mysqlbug script!
 
The latest information about MySQL is available on the web at
http://www.mysql.com
Support MySQL by buying support/licenses at https://order.mysql.com
 
 
Le problème survient quand j'exécute la commande
 
mysqladmin -u root password 'password'
 
 
Le message suivant apparaît:
 
mysqladmin: connect to server at 'localhost' failed
error: 'Can't connect to local MySQL server through socket '/var/run/mysql/mysql.sock' (2)'
Check that mysqld is running and that the socket: '/var/run/mysql/mysql.sock' exists!
 
 
Le socket n'a pu être créé ? Mysql_install_db aurait échoué ?

mood
Publicité
Posté le 28-07-2004 à 21:23:53  profilanswer
 

n°529711
Klaimant
?
Posté le 28-07-2004 à 21:25:08  profilanswer
 

ton serveur tourne ??
 
ps aux ?


---------------
Fais le ou ne le fais pas, mais il n'y a pas d'essai !!!
n°529776
Plouf02
Opencloud addict!
Posté le 28-07-2004 à 23:12:07  profilanswer
 

a mon avis, le service a pas ete demarré avt de lancer ta commande ;)

n°529832
Pierre-Luc
Posté le 29-07-2004 à 02:06:24  profilanswer
 

Le démarrage semble aussi faire défaut:
 
root@henry:~# mysqld_safe &
[1] 20861
root@henry:~# Starting mysqld daemon with databases from /var/lib/mysql
040728 19:06:48  mysqld ended
 
 
[1]+  Done                    mysqld_safe
root@henry:~#
 
 
 

n°529833
Pierre-Luc
Posté le 29-07-2004 à 02:09:05  profilanswer
 

Quoiqu'en repensant à ce que mysql dit: "Starting mysqld daemon with databases from /var/lib/mysql", il est certain qu'il puisse y avoir une erreur. En effet aucune base de donnée n'est encore créée. C'est une idée comme ça...

n°529899
Cruchot
Posté le 29-07-2004 à 09:18:14  profilanswer
 

Par défaut la base 'mysql' existe après l'install.
 
Tu dois avoir un fichier 'nomdetamachine'.err sous /var/lib/mysql. Il y a quoi dedans ?


Message édité par Cruchot le 29-07-2004 à 09:19:56
n°530181
Pierre-Luc
Posté le 29-07-2004 à 14:58:05  profilanswer
 

Voilà le contenu de ce fichier:
 
040728 19:06:45  mysqld started
040728 19:06:46  InnoDB: Started
040728 19:06:46  Fatal error: Can't open privilege tables: Can't find file: './m ysql/host.frm' (errno: 13)
040728 19:06:46  Aborting
 
040728 19:06:46  InnoDB: Starting shutdown...
040728 19:06:48  InnoDB: Shutdown completed
040728 19:06:48  /usr/libexec/mysqld: Shutdown Complete
 
040728 19:06:48  mysqld ended
 

n°530266
Cruchot
Posté le 29-07-2004 à 16:25:37  profilanswer
 

Le fichier host.frm il est bien au bon endroit ? Quels sont ses droits ?

n°538941
polytan
wait & see
Posté le 12-08-2004 à 16:42:39  profilanswer
 

Pierre-Luc a écrit :

Le problème survient quand j'exécute la commande
 
mysqladmin -u root password 'password'
 
 
Le message suivant apparaît:
 
mysqladmin: connect to server at 'localhost' failed
error: 'Can't connect to local MySQL server through socket '/var/run/mysql/mysql.sock' (2)'
Check that mysqld is running and that the socket: '/var/run/mysql/mysql.sock' exists!
 
 
Le socket n'a pu être créé ? Mysql_install_db aurait échoué ?


 
essaie avec la commade dans le dossier ou il y a tous les fichiers pour MySQL (/usr/lib je crois)
 
# mysql -u root -p


---------------
-=( Polytan )=-

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Linux et OS Alternatifs

  Problème de lancement Mysql

 

Sujets relatifs
[K3B] Problème gravage DVD+RW[XFree => XORG] problème de font avec firefox | résolu
[dosemu] Probleme avec le clavierDebian SID : aidez-moi à résoudre ce problème de dépendance
[Mandrake 10 RC1 AMD64] Problème d'installation des pilotes NForce 3petit probleme avec script
debian + gnome, probleme dans mon menu....probleme configuration wifi
[Xfree] probleme de souris immobile sous X [Résolut] 
Plus de sujets relatifs à : Problème de lancement Mysql


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R